| diff --git a/abs/core-testing/grub-gfx/install-grub b/abs/core-testing/grub-gfx/install-grub new file mode 100755 index 0000000..3eb7ce5 --- /dev/null +++ b/abs/core-testing/grub-gfx/install-grub @@ -0,0 +1,187 @@ +#!/bin/bash + +# +# This is a little helper script that tries to convert linux-style device +# names to grub-style.  It's not very smart, so it +# probably won't work for more complicated setups. +# +# If it doesn't work for you, try installing grub manually: +# +#    # mkdir -p /boot/grub +#    # cp /usr/lib/grub/i386-pc/* /boot/grub/ +# +# Then start up the 'grub' shell and run something like the following: +# +#    grub> root(hd0,0) +#    grub> setup(hd0) +# +# The "root" line should point to the partition your kernel is located on, +# /boot if you have a separate boot partition, otherwise your root (/). +# +# The "setup" line tells grub which disc/partition to install the +# bootloader to.
